Start Date: November 16, 2025
End Date: November 16, 2025
Time: 12:00 pm To 3:00 pm
Location: 1500 Sugar Bowl Drive, New Orleans, LA, USA
Home and Away Games
www.Ticketmaster.com
Visited 35 times, 1 Visit today
Review
Name *
Email *
Website